# Contact: Tarnwick Image Cache Memory Leak

Support staff handling tickets about degraded performance in the Tarnwick viewer should be aware of a known memory leak in the image cache layer. Symptoms include gradual slowdown after several hours of use and eventual tab crashes. A fix is in progress; the interim workaround is asking users to restart the client daily. Log affected accounts in the tracker with the "cache-leak" tag. For escalations or questions about the fix timeline, contact the owning team at the address below.

alerts address for kajog-tadup: druox@plorvanet.internal

Q3 cash-flow forecast review — Vantorra Systems. Operating inflows tracking 4% under plan, driven by slower collections in the Merivale region. Outflows stable; capex on the Driftline upgrade deferred to Q4. Net position remains positive but the buffer narrows to six weeks by October. Finance to tighten receivables follow-up and re-run the model after month-end close. The directional assumption behind the revised forecast is noted below.

internal memo for bajep-kaduf: Ulaokax Works is in early talks to buy Olidorek Group for about $36.1 million. The Kasax launch date is November 22, and nothing goes to the press before then.

- [ ] **Step 7: Breaker override escrow.** After sealing the signing keys for the Tallgrove upstream API circuit breaker, confirm the support team can force the breaker open during a full outage. The override bundle lives in the sealed escrow drawer and is useless without its unlock phrase. Two ceremony witnesses must initial this step before proceeding. The escrow bundle is decrypted with the recovery passphrase that follows.

vault phrase of kahip-kahop = holath-quenmir